The resumed steps of the Citric acid cycle are as follows,

1) Acetyl CoA joins an oxaloacetate molecule, which is a 4C molecule. They release the CoA group and form a 6C molecule called Citrate.

                      Acetil CoA + Oxalacetato → Citrato + CoA group

2) Citrate turns into an isomere Isocitrate

3) Isocitrate oxidates and release 1 CO₂ molecule, producing an α- ketoglutarate molecule -this is a 5C molecule-. Meanwhile, NAD+ reduces to NADH.

                    Isocitrate + NAD+ → α-cetoglutarate + CO₂ + NADH

4) α-ketoglutarate oxidates and release 1 CO₂ molecule, producing a 4C molecule, which joins a Coenzyme A producing Succinyl-CoA. Meanwhile,  NAD+ reduces to NADH.

          α-cetoglutarate + NAD+ → 4C molecule + CO₂ + NADH

          4C molecule + Coenzyme A → Succinil-CoA

5) CoA from Succinyl-CoA is substituted with a phosphate group, which then forms ATP. The final product is Succinate and ATP

       Succinyl-CoA + Phosphate group + ADP → Succinate + ATP + CoA

6) Succinate oxidizes and forms Fumarate, a 4C molecule. FAD+ forms FAH₂

                     Succinate + FAD+ → Fumarate + FADH₂

7) A water molecule and Fumarate produce Malate, which is another 4C molecule

                                Fumarate + H₂O → Malate

8) Finally, malate oxidizes and oxalacetate regenerates -the initial 4C compound-. NAD+ reduces to NADH.

                     Malato + NAD+ → Oxalacetate + NADH

So, when acetyl-CoA enters the cycle, it associates with a 4-carbon molecule (Oxalacetate), forming citric acid, and then through redox reactions regenerates the 4-carbon molecule (Oxalacetate).

The autonomic nervous system is divided into two; the sympathetic and parasympathetic nervous system. The autonomic nervous system controls the involuntary actions of internal organs and glands.

The sympathetic nervous system originate from the spinal cord and and it's is responsible for accelerateing the heart rate, constricting blood vessels, and raising blood pressure. Thereby preparing the body to fight or fight response against any danger.

The parasympathetic nervous is a part of autonomic nervous system that also originate from the spinal cord which which slows the heart rate, increases intestinal and gland activity, and relaxes sphincter muscles. By doing this,it prevent the body from overworking itself and restore the body to a calm and composed state.

what are chloroplasts? why are they green? how is the green colour plant of a great importance to the whole living world? explain​?

Answers

Answer:

Chloroplasts are structures found in the cytoplasm of plant cells that are the site for photosynthesis. They are green because they contain a pigment called chlorophyll.  Chlorophyll absorbs light to bring about the photosynthesis reaction. Light energy is crucial to initiate photosynthesis.

Photosynthesis allows the plant to convert carbon dioxide from air and water absorbed from the roots into oxygen and glucose, which are foods for plants. By releasing oxygen to air through photosynthesis, other living things can breathe in oxygen so that energy can be generated through another process, called respiration. Respiration is like the reverse reaction of photosynthesis, but it turns glucose to energy that supports living things.

Because plants also respire to generate energy, by using the glucose produced from photosynthesis, it also supports the food chain in the living world. Other organisms can consume plants for their energy.

In the end, chloroplasts and the chlorophyll inside are very important to the living world.

What are digestive enzymes? Give three examples of digestive enzymes and briefly describe their specific functions.

Answers

Answer:

Digestive enzymes are the natural substances our body needs to help  break down and digest food

We have three main digestive enzymes :

Proteases: These enzymes break down protein into small peptides and amino acids.

Lipases: break down fat into three fatty acids plus a glycerol molecule.

Amylases: Are responsible for breaking  down carbs like starch into simple sugars.

Explanation:

Digestive enzymes are proteins that catalyze mainly hydrolysis reactions that make nutrients absorbable in the digestive tract. Pepsin is a gastric enzyme that turns proteins into albumoses and peptones which are shorter peptide chains that are then hydrolyzed to even shorter chains until amino acids by intestinal enzymes. Pancreatic amylase is an enzyme that turns starch(a polysaccharide) into maltose(a disaccharide). Lipase is present in the gastric juice, the pancreatic juice, and the intestinal juice. This enzyme catalyzes the hydrolysis of lipids(mainly triglycerides) into fatty acids and glycerol. When incomplete hydrolysis occurs triglycerides can become monoglycerides.
